summary

This article discusses the increasing popularity of coloring as a recreational activity for adults. It highlights the rise of adult coloring books and the therapeutic benefits associated with coloring. The article explores the reasons behind this trend, including the desire for stress relief, nostalgia, and the need for a break from digital screens. It also mentions the impact of social media in spreading the popularity of adult coloring. The article concludes by suggesting that coloring has become a normalized and accepted activity for adults, serving as a form of relaxation and creative expression in a fast-paced digital world.
